Achieve closes its second debt settlement fee securitization

June 22, 2026 7:00 AM EDT

$151.4 million in rated notes backed by fees earned through Achieve Debt Relief

SAN MATEO, Calif., June 22, 2026 /PRNewswire/ -- Achieve, the leader in digital personal finance, announces the June 18 closing of a $151.4 million debt settlement fee asset-backed securitization.

The securitization, ACHD Trust 2026-DS1, includes three classes of rated notes. The notes are secured by debt settlement fees arising under debt settlement programs for U.S. consumers.

Jefferies served as Initial Purchaser and Sole Bookrunner of the deal. Kroll Bond Rating Agency assigned the following ratings: Class A: BBB- (sf), Class B: BB- (sf) and Class C: B- (sf). DBRS Morningstar assigned the following ratings: Class A: BBB (sf), Class B: BB (sf) and Class C: B (low) (sf).

The transaction builds on the momentum of Achieve's inaugural debt settlement fee securitization completed in December 2025 and further expands the company's robust and diverse capital markets capabilities. Achieve's financing platform includes investment-grade, rated personal loan, home equity loan and debt settlement fee securitizations, as well as a variety of personal loan, home equity loan and debt settlement fee warehouses and other financing transactions.
